871813-33-1,871813-36-4,871814-42-5,865194-87-2,90445-14-0,170650-79-0 Supplier | CHEMTAOBAO.COM
CMO CDMO service. CHEMTAOBAO.COM supply 871813-33-1,871813-36-4,871814-42-5,865194-87-2,90445-14-0,170650-79-0 and related compounds.
871814-42-5 865194-87-2 90445-14-0 170650-79-0 871813-36-4 871813-33-1